| Title | Chinese New Year in Boise, ca. 1900 |
| Description | Chinese New Year along Main Street and 7th Avenue in Boise, Idaho. Participants parade though the street with banners. To the left is the Business and Shorthand College. Donated by Mike Feiler. |
| Date | ca. 1900 |
